本文目录一览:
JAVA开发提效工具,IDEA必备插件
SonarLint:提供代码质量检查,帮助开发者及时发现并修正潜在问题。1 Spring WebSocket:简化WebSocket协议的使用,方便实现实时通信功能。1 TONGYI Lingma - Your AI Coding Assistant:利用AI辅助编程,提高开发效率。
CodeGlance - 缩放图插件在大量代码中,通过代码缩略图快速定位和跳转,提高浏览效率。 Translation - 翻译利器内置多种翻译引擎,方便在IDEA内实时翻译英文代码和注释。 RestfulToolkit - API测试工具确保RESTful API的正确性和一致性,提升测试效率。
首先,JRebel 是一款由爱沙尼亚公司 ZeroTurnaround 开发的 Java 应用热部署插件。它允许在开发过程中无需重启应用即可实时应用代码变更。安装并配置之后,只需在运行或调试时开启热部署,就能显著提升效率。在服务层编写业务代码时,无需再进行重启操作,加载最新的配置变得轻松快捷。
HZERO Tools聚焦于HZERO项目交付过程中的低效、重复与不规范开发场景,通过IDEA内置插件提供提效与解决途径。代码生成功能一键生成脚手架代码,减少重复编码。快速搜索功能简化代码探索过程。SQL日志转化功能将日志一键转化为SQL语句,方便分析与优化。使用HZERO Copilot需在IDEA中搜索并安装插件。
7个超级好用的高效率软件工具
护眼助手:LightBulb 根据时间和地理位置自动调校屏幕的护眼软件,让你的眼睛在任何环境下都能得到舒适的体验。 在线工具宝藏:独特工具箱 这个网站提供了上百个在线工具,涵盖开发、编码、学习等多个领域,无需注册,免费使用,方便你的工作和学习需求。
微软To-Do - 效率管理神器 微软推出的To-Do,简洁易用的待办列表软件。不论是工作、学习还是生活,它都能助你规划日程,提高效率,让生活有序。 Todoist - 任务管理专家 Todoist是一款支持跨平台的任务管理应用,被上百万用户信赖。
番茄人生 - 一款基于番茄工作法的待办事项管理软件,Windows版功能全面,免费下载。它能帮助你规划时间,提升工作效率,让你的每一天都井井有条,工作报表一键导出,轻松掌握进度。
*SpaceSniffer 强大Windows磁盘分析工具,快速分析磁盘分布,识别并删除大文件,优化硬盘空间管理。*Vivaldi浏览器 简洁美观,支持100多种主题,使用Chrome内核,兼容所有扩展,支持多屏同时浏览,提高工作效率。这些软件各具特色,集实用与黑科技于一身,希望能在您的电脑上发挥重要作用。
Fences:桌面整理专家,帮助你创建整洁的工作空间,提供多桌面效果,适合整理强迫症者。方方格子:Excel功能强大的工具箱,解决999%的办公问题,且支持32位和64位Office。Quicker:综合办公效率软件,包含启动器、记事本、OCR等众多功能,简化日常操作。
-Zip是Windows下处理压缩包的开源工具,支持7z、ZIP、GZIP、BZIPTAR格式,其他格式也能解压缩,软件轻便,压缩功能强大。ublock是一款轻量级广告过滤插件,CPU和内存消耗极少,能拦截恶意网站和过滤广告,保护隐私。支持自定义规则,预设规则已足够清净。
看板(KANBAN)——团队提质增效必备工具
1、Todoist是一款在国外非常出名的任务管理软件,为个人和团队提供看板管理功能。它允许添加新的看板,将已有的清单转换为看板模式,结合任务管理和看板使用,并支持协作功能。Todoist的优点是丰富的Web服务,支持多人协作模式,但客户端本质上是个加壳Web页面,对Native支持较差,不支持原生快捷键。
2、大企业看板工具软件:软件开发项目看板 PingCode;通用看板软件 Worktile;开源看板软件 Wekan;免费看板软件 Trello;个人和小团队的看板软件 Todoist ;开源免费看 Kanboard;面向个人免费的看板 Teambition;软件开发项目看板 Jira;开源项目看板 LibreBoard;开源看板 Jitamin。
软件开发需要哪些设备
软件开发需要的硬件包括:计算机:开发者需要至少一台计算机作为开发环境。这可以是台式机或笔记本电脑,具备足够的处理能力和存储空间。外部显示器:一个或多个高分辨率的显示器可以提供更大的工作区域,方便同时查看和编辑多个代码文件。
软件运行环境一般包括以下几个主要方面: 硬件环境:软件需要运行的硬件设备,如处理器、内存、硬盘空间等。这些是软件运行的基本条件。 软件环境:软件需要依赖的操作系统、数据库、网络协议等软件环境。这些环境决定了软件的功能和性能。
软件开发需要的设备主要包括: 个人电脑。 显示器。 稳定的网络连接设备。接下来进行详细解释:个人电脑是软件开发的核心设备。软件开发需要执行复杂的计算任务和运行多种开发工具,因此,高性能的CPU和大容量内存是必备条件。此外,为了提升开发效率和存储需求,高速固态硬盘也是不可或缺的部分。
软件开发需要的硬件设备主要包括以下几个方面:计算机:软件开发过程中需要使用一台或多台计算机来进行编程、调试和测试等任务。计算机应具备足够的处理能力和内存容量,以应对开发过程中的复杂计算和资源需求。
输入设备:舒适的键盘、鼠标或触控板等输入设备对于长时间的编码和开发工作至关重要。总体而言,具体的要求取决于开发者所从事的具体领域和使用的工具。较大或复杂的项目可能需要更高配置的电脑来保证开发效率和质量。以上内容是由猪八戒网精心整理,希望对您有所帮助。